
Visit one of the most impressive and unique Major League Baseball facilities in the country -- Chase Field, home of the 2001 World Champion Arizona Diamondbacks and the 2011 MLB All-Star Game. Chase Field has several unique features including dbTV, one of the largest high definition video scoreboards in MLB, a retractable roof to keep fans cool during the summer months, the D-backs Pool in right field and the Coors Light Strike Zone.

Chase Field Tour Details
- Tours last approximately 75 minutes.
- This is a walking tour, so please dress accordingly.
Elevators are used several times during the course of the tour. Please let your tour guide know in advance if this presents any challenges. - Tours are wheelchair accessible, and wheelchairs are available for your use during the tour.
You may request a wheelchair at the Tour Ticket Window prior to the tour. - The majority of the tour route is NOT air-conditioned.
- Please note that backpacks, large bags, and food and drink (except water) are prohibited.
- Each fan may carry one bag that is clear plastic, vinyl, or PVC no larger than 12" by x 6" x 12" or a one-gallon clear plastic freezer bag (Ziploc bag or similar). Additionally, fans may also carry a small clutch purse no larger than 4.5" x 6.5", with or without a handle or strap, that is subject to search. - Cameras, video cameras and bottled water are permitted.
- Cell phones and pagers are permitted, providing their use does not interfere with other guests' enjoyment of the tour.
- The tour does not go on to the playing field.
- Parking is available at the Chase Field Garage, located just south of the Ballpark. Present your parking ticket to receive a special parking validation for discounted hourly parking.
- No Tours will be held on the days of day games, major holidays, and special events.
